Significance: The bridge provided for a single railroad track to cross the Ocmulgee River at River Mile 135.4 until 1988 when railroad operations were permanently abandoned.
Survey number: HAER GA-75
Building/structure dates: 1890 Initial Construction
Building/structure dates: 1975 Subsequent Work
Building/structure dates: 1988 Subsequent Work - Local Identifier:
